Question Correct rim size

Hello I have 20" rim on my SC400. Bought the car with the rims already on. They are size 245/35/20 and I was wondering if that is the correct size for 20" on an SC.
Someone said it may be the wrong offset and I think at times it rubs against part of the suspension on the inside of the wheelwell. If they are the wrong size can someone please correct me so I can put on the right size rim?

If the rims/tires are rubbing on the suspension the offset is way too high. I would go with some 18's or 19's with a lower offset, which will space the wheel away from the suspension.
